LIVESTRONG at the YMCA is a collaborative with the YMCA of the USA and the Lance Armstrong Foundation to better understand the needs, wants and interests of cancer survivors. It is the goal of the YMCA Healthy Living Center to support cancer survivor’s pursuit of health and well-being by creating and implementing programs that fit the needs of our cancer survivors.
Today’s evidence supports physical activity as a critical part of living with cancer. Cancer survivors: those who are living with, through and beyond cancer diagnosis; are becoming aware of the positive impacts that physical activity, a healthful diet and stress reduction techniques can have on their quality of life.
The Healthy Living Center’s LIVESTRONG at the YMCA exercise/fitness programs for cancer survivors require a doctor’s referral. Referrals should be faxed to 515-244-5570. Participants will be evaluated by medical or fitness professionals and a program will be designed to meet each participant's specific needs. Individual sessions with Medical Program Instructors will be scheduled by appointment. Individuals have the choice to do their workouts on their own at anytime or during class time when other LIVESTRONG participants are working out.

LYMPHEDEMA AQUATIC EXERCISE CLASS
Open to all Lymphedema patients. This program will assist patients to regain their strength, extremity range of motion, assist with lymphatic drainage, and daily lifestyle function. Taught by a Mercy Lymphedema Certified Therapist this class will teach healthy exercise and safety concepts.
